"Novice to Pro: Essential Tips for Graphic Designers"

In this video, Will Paterson, a seasoned graphic designer with over a decade of experience, shares his invaluable advice for beginners entering the world of graphic design. From problem-solving for clients to focusing on constant improvement, Will discusses the importance of maintaining a balance between creativity and business acumen.

Key points include:

Recognising that graphic design is as much about problem-solving as it is about artistry.
Understanding that it's okay to have weaknesses and working towards strengthening them.
Drawing inspiration from different sources and not limiting oneself to graphic design.
The importance of carrying a sketchbook to capture ideas as they come.
Finding a passion outside of your main work to keep creativity flowing.
Realising that everyone has doubts about their abilities and accepting that as part of the learning process.
Embracing failure as a part of the process.
Loving the process as much as the end goal.
Will also recommends the book "Atomic Habits" for anyone looking to improve their daily routines to achieve their goals more efficiently.
